Forklift lithium batteries are designed to power electric forklifts and other material handling equipment. They are known for their lightweight design, rapid charging capabilities, longer lifespan, and minimal maintenance requirements. Unlike conventional batteries, lithium batteries do not suffer from the memory effect, allowing them to be charged at any time without the risk of diminished capacity. Their application spans various industries, including warehousing, manufacturing, and distribution centers.

Cost of the Battery
The upfront cost of a forklift lithium battery can vary significantly from brand to brand. On average, these batteries can range from $5,000 to $15,000, depending on capacity and specifications. While the initial investment might seem high compared to traditional lead-acid batteries, it’s essential to consider the long-term savings on maintenance and energy costs. Businesses should assess the overall budget and financing options while evaluating forklift lithium battery prices.
Battery Capacity and Performance
Another critical factor that impacts forklift lithium battery price is its capacity, typically measured in amp-hours (Ah). A higher capacity battery will provide more operational hours before needing a recharge, making it suitable for intensive applications. In contrast, lower-capacity batteries may suffice for lighter operations. Deciding on the right capacity depends on your specific operational needs. Higher-capacity batteries usually come with a higher price tag, but they can also enhance efficiency and productivity over time.

When considering the forklift lithium battery price, it is essential to evaluate the existing charging infrastructure. Lithium batteries require specific charging stations designed for their chemistry. If your facility lacks the necessary equipment, additional investments in charging infrastructure will factor into the total cost. Furthermore, lithium batteries can often be charged quickly, allowing for opportunity charging which can enhance operational uptime. Assessing your current charging capabilities will help you avoid unexpected costs and ensure a seamless transition.
Lifespan and Warranty
The lifespan of a forklift lithium battery is significantly longer compared to lead-acid batteries, often exceeding 4,000 charge cycles. Businesses should consider this factor while evaluating forklift lithium battery prices. A longer lifespan translates to fewer replacements over time and can lead to substantial cost savings. Additionally, consider the warranty offered by manufacturers. A solid warranty can provide peace of mind regarding long-term performance and reliability. Investing in a quality battery with a robust warranty may justify a higher initial expenditure.
